What is the difference between Fusion middleware and WebLogic?

Oracle Fusion Middleware is a suite of products that includes Oracle WebLogic Server, WebCenter,content, WebCenter portal, identity, and access management tier, Oracle web tier and other components that sets between Oracle Database and it deploys and builds business applications using Oracle fusion middleware.

Is WebLogic a middleware?

Oracle WebLogic Server forms part of Oracle Fusion Middleware portfolio and supports Oracle, DB2, Microsoft SQL Server, MySQL Enterprise and other JDBC-compliant databases. Oracle WebLogic Platform also includes: WebLogic Integration.

What is the Oracle Fusion Middleware environment?

After you install and configure Oracle Fusion Middleware, your Oracle Fusion Middleware environment contains the following: An Oracle WebLogic Server domain, which contains one Administration Server and one or more Managed Servers.

Fusion Middleware Control is a Web-based administration console used to manage Oracle Fusion Middleware, including components such as Oracle HTTP Server, Oracle SOA Suite, Oracle WebCenter, Oracle Portal, and Oracle Identity Management. Managed Servers host business applications, application components, Web services, and their associated resources.

What is a Java component in WebLogic?

A Java component, which is an Oracle Fusion Middleware component that is deployed as one or more Java EE applications and a set of resources. Java components are deployed to an Oracle WebLogic Server domain as part of a domain template.
